OqPoWah.com

Faze reševanja problemov na računalniku in njihovih značilnosti

Če želite izvedeti vse faze reševanja težav na računalniku, jih morate podrobneje seznaniti. Tisti, ki imajo vsaj idejo o tem, kaj je elektronski računalnik, bo to vprašanje lažje razumeti. Toda tisti, ki se prvič srečuje s to okrajšavo, se bo moral naučiti veliko novih stvari.

Koncept

O računalnikih so skoraj vsi slišali, a zelo malo ljudi ve, kaj je. Kot pravi Wikipedia, pred nami je kompleks tehničnih sredstev. Celo takšna razlaga lahko malo pojasnjuje. Skratka, gre za napravo ali mehanizem, ki je opremljen z določenimi funkcijami. Med njimi so logični ukrepi, pomnilnik, indikacija itd.faze reševanja nalog na računalnikih

Vsak od njih je na elektronskem elementu. Slednje pa so odgovorne za avtomatsko obdelavo informacij v določenih procesih. Razumejo se kot računske ali informativne naloge.

Značilnosti

Preden so se oblikovale faze reševanja problemov na računalniku, se je ta izraz iskal sam. Mnogi verjamejo, da je računalnik računalnik. Toda zadnja naprava ima širšo funkcionalnost in zato nekoliko nepravično znižana.

Natančneje, ta stroj se izvaja kot kalkulator. Za izvajanje vseh procesov uporablja elektronske komponente kot funkcionalna vozlišča. Takšen kompleks tehničnih sredstev se lahko razlikuje od drugih.

Na primer, izračuni so možni na drug način. To vključuje mehansko, biološko, optično, kvantno različico. Računalnik deluje na principu transporta mehaničnih delov, gibljivih elektronov in fotonov.

Oblivion

Če danes govorimo o računalnikih kot računalnik, potem samo v preteklosti. Pravzaprav nihče v življenju tega ne uporablja, pogosteje pa se izgovarja zvok iz ust digitalnih elektronskih inženirjev. Stroj se lahko pojavi v pravni dokumentaciji, torej in v skladu s tem v zgodovinskih poročilih.glavne faze reševanja problemov na računalnikih

V slednjem primeru gre za računalniško tehnologijo, ki je bila rojena leta 1940-80.

Faze

Če govorimo o fazah reševanja težav na računalniku, za ta računalnik prejmemo računalnik. To je v našem času omenjeno programiranje in njegove faze. Ta proces vključuje teoretične in praktične procese, ki so povezani z oblikovanjem programov. Njihova rešitev vsebuje več stopenj, od katerih nekateri sploh ne potrebujejo računalnika.

Takoj je treba opozoriti, da ni jasnega zaporedja algoritma. Obstajajo nekaj odstopanj, ki se posebej nanašajo na naloge.

Cilj

Prvi korak pri reševanju težav z uporabo računalnika je oblikovanje naloge. Programator ali inženir mora zbrati vse informacije o nalogi. Potem bo potrebno oblikovati pogoje. To pomeni, da je treba razumeti, s kakšnimi sredstvi bodo doseženi cilji.faze reševanja problemov z uporabo računalnikov

Potem morate določiti želeni rezultat. To je, kaj želimo dobiti zaradi nekaterih dejanj in izračunov. Nato ugotovimo, kako bomo dobili rešitev v kakšni obliki in obliki. Na koncu te faze morate opisati vse obstoječe podatke. Preprosto povedano, se spomnite šole in rešitve problemov v fiziki, ko so bile omenjene vse razpoložljive količine, strukture, vrste itd.

Analiza

Faze reševanja problemov na računalniku vodijo k analizi. Ta korak mora programer upoštevati obstoječe analoge. To pomeni, da preučimo predhodno prenesene postopke programiranja. Po tem morate analizirati strojno in programsko opremo.

Na drugi stopnji ni treba pozabiti, da bi oblikovali matematični model. Morda bi našli nekaj bolj poenostavljenih načinov reševanja problema, na katerem lahko stroj opravlja izračune. Nato strukturirajte podatke.

Algoritem

Če na kratko preučimo korake reševanja problemov na računalnikih, bi razvoj algoritma precej vstopil v eno od prej predlaganih faz. To je še en pomemben korak v podrobnejšem opisu po korakih. Tukaj morate skrbeti za izbiro procesov, povezanih z algoritmi.faze priprave in reševanja nalog na računalnikih

Inženir izbere metoda načrtovanja algoritem, da bi natančneje razumeli, katere stopnje pričakuje. In po - razumeti obliko snemanja algoritma. Obstaja veliko možnosti. Glede na sposobnosti in tehnologijo modernosti, potem so poleg blokovnih diagramov možne tudi kompleksnejše oblike, kot so animacije.




Po tej fazi se upoštevajo preskusi in metode njihovega ravnanja. Morate najti zanesljive možnosti preverjanja. Na koncu lahko sami oblikujete algoritem.

Programiranje

Na glavne faze reševanja problemov na računalniku je treba vključiti programiranje. Pravzaprav je glavni korak v celotnem izračunu. Odgovoriti ga morate odgovorno. Za začetek programator izbere jezik, na katerem bo napisana programska oprema. Po preučitvi možnih možnosti za strukturiranje in združevanje podatkov. Tukaj vsakemu svojemu. Nekdo lahko uporabi improvizirane metode, nekdo - naloži posebne programe.

Potem je algoritem napisan v izbranem jeziku. Tukaj je vse na splošno razumljivo in ni težav, če se profesionalec ukvarja z njo.

Testiranje

Ko je delo dejansko končano, morate preveriti njegovo učinkovitost. Za to so potrebni preizkusi in odpravljanje napak. Najprej se izvede sintaktično odpravljanje napak. Po tem se preveri semantika in logična struktura. Kot kaže praksa, se na teh dveh stopnjah pogosto odkrijejo napake, ki so bile storjene neutemeljeno.faze reševanja problemov z uporabo računalnikov

Izvedite izračune testov in preverite rezultate. Tukaj morate biti še posebej previdni in kvalitativno analizirati rezultate, saj lahko celo najmanjša odstopanja škodijo celotnemu delu.

Na tej stopnji ostaja program popravljen. Vsak simbol lahko neodvisno preverite ali pa s pomočjo aplikacij najdete netočnosti. Možno je spremeniti strukturiranje.

Preverjanje

Predzadnja faza priprave in reševanja nalog na računalniku je pogojno neobvezna, čeprav je priporočljiva. Zaželeno je, da ga ne zamudite. Da bi to naredili, moramo analizirati rezultate reševanja problema in izboljšav. Če je v tej fazi nekaj težav, je bolje ponoviti vse zgoraj navedene korake, da bi se izognili kakršnim koli netočnostim.

Podpora

Zadnja stopnja se lahko šteje za osnovno, vendar dodatno. Izvesti ga je treba po potrebi. Na primer, spremenite program, če za to obstajajo dodatne zahteve. Morda bo na seznam vključenih nekaj nalog, ki jih je mogoče zlahka dodati v algoritem.faze reševanja uporabnih problemov na računalnikih

Tudi na zadnji stopnji je mišljeno poročilo, ki se posreduje naročniku, ali pa ga naredi zase. V prvem primeru je treba zagotoviti, da programerja ni zahtevkov. V drugem primeru je morda potrebno nadaljnje delo s projektom.

Kratko delo

Opisane faze reševanja problemov z uporabo računalnikov so obsežnejše. Če je projekt majhen, ali ne potrebuje takšne vzvišenosti, je mogoče uporabiti krajšo pot.

V tem primeru se lahko formulacija problema in izgradnja matematičnega modela združita v en postopek. Toda prav tako bo treba najprej razumeti cilje naloge, mu dati točno formulacijo, preučiti možne faze rešitve. Razumeti, v kakšni obliki bodo rezultati zabeleženi in kako bodo shranjeni.

Po tej pripravljalni fazi je treba opis matematike v matematičnem smislu. Torej specialist dobi idealiziran matematični model, a kot celota daje smer rešitvi problema. Da bi bil model pravilen, je treba analizirati podobne rešitve, tehnične in programske opreme, pogoje za obstoj rezultatov.

Druga faza je algoritem in njegovo izvajanje. Programator se pogosteje ukvarja s tem, kakovostno izvajanje pa je odvisno od njegove klasifikacije. Algoritem sam po sebi zbira že pripravljen matematični model in končno zaporedje receptov. Vse to lahko uresničimo z uveljavljenimi metodami.faze reševanja nalog na računalniku na kratko

Poleg tega bo zadoščalo za obravnavo "čistega" programiranja, da bi izvajali vse predhodno zasnovane akcije.

No, faze reševanja uporabljenih problemov na računalnikih končajo, kot vedno, testiranje in podporo. S pomočjo odpravljanja napak se razkrijejo vse tehnične, slovnične in algoritemske napake. Kontrolno testiranje jih popravi in ​​prinaša projekt v ustrezno obliko.

Sklepi

Kot smo že omenili, so stopnje lahko drugačne in se razlikujejo glede na napredek in inovacije. Zanimivo je, da se vloga osebe in računalnika v tem procesu lahko razlikuje glede na naloge in priložnosti. Tudi to vpliva na razvoj računalniške tehnologije. Nedaleč je čas, ko bo katera od faz avtomatizirana in ne bo potrebovala človeškega dela.

Zdieľať na sociálnych sieťach:

Príbuzný